How much do development services man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 4, 2026, the average yearly pay for development services manager in the United States is $77,438.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$58,500.00 and $90,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Development Services Manager?

A Development Services Manager is responsible for overseeing and coordinating various development projects within an organization, often related to construction, land development, or municipal planning. They manage teams, budgets, project timelines, and ensure compliance with local regulations and standards. This role involves working closely with stakeholders, developers, and government agencies to facilitate the successful completion of projects. Development Services Managers also streamline processes and provide guidance to ensure efficient service delivery and customer satisfaction.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Development Services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Development Services Manager, you need strong project management skills, expertise in urban planning or development, and a relevant bachelor's degree or higher. Familiarity with permitting software, GIS systems, and knowledge of building codes and zoning regulations are typically required. Exceptional leadership, negotiation, and communication skills help in coordinating teams and engaging with diverse stakeholders. These competencies ensure efficient service delivery, regulatory compliance, and successful community development projects.

Join Our Team as the Development Services Manager
The Town of Hilton Head Island is seeking a dynamic and experienced Development Services Manager to manage staff and functions of various divisions including customer service, permit application and inspection management, site development, code enforcement and interpretation and urban design.
What You Will Do
  • Oversee, direct, organize, and coordinate the implementation of Town Council annual goals, the Strategic Plan agenda and special projects
  • Provide managerial direction to Division staff and ensure coordination and consistency and an environment of contact improvements
  • Ensure development applications, redevelopment program, and special projects are consistent with the Comprehensive Plan and all codes
  • Coordinate amendments to Land Management Ordinance and Municipal Code; assist Division Managers with natural resource protection and design projects
  • Assist LMO Official with LMO interpretation to ensure consistency
  • Coordinate with Legal Services Division and inspectors to enforce Land Management Ordinance
  • Work with public, staff, and board members to resolve disputes and problems with applications and procedures
  • Oversee various board functions, including coordination, training, advertisement, and meetings

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ree and eight (8) years of related experience; or an equivalent combination of education and experience
  • Valid Driver's License
